Ladysmith Black Mambazo was founded over thirty years ago and have averaged the release of an album a year. This compilation of re-worked L.B.M. songs begins with the first song founder Joseph Shabalala ever wrote for the group, which came to him in a dream from the voice of God. The album also features contributions from several other famous artists. -PeteMilagro Acustico
